mrcanada wrote...

Why the decision to go for re-skins on the remaining characters when others are already created and available to use? For instance, the female Krogan model for the Shaman, one of the SP skins for the Valkryrie or at the very least the Justicar armor. With these examples, I only assume the rest of the incoming characters are re-skins and while welcome additions, I can't help but feel this is a slightly missed opportunity for even more individuality amongst our character selections.


Something like the Krogan Shaman skin is not loaded into memory for MP so it would have been a memory hit.

Anything that wasnt already in MP would have been a memory hit. The new classes were an oppurtunity to put out some extra variety. Realistically it came to do to do we need them as is or we do we not add them at all.
